About

Experience the thrill of college basketball's three-point contest. Choose your favorite ACC team and compete in various shooting challenges, from 'around the world' to tournament brackets. Test your skills against others online and aim for those crucial money balls.

Around the world shooting contest
Tournament bracket play
Online multiplayer matchups
Money ball scoring
Play as your favorite ACC team

FAQ

What is ACC 3 Point Challenge?

ACC 3 Point Challenge is a mobile game that simulates college basketball three-point shooting contests. Players can select their favorite ACC school and compete in various shooting challenges, including 'around the world' and tournament brackets.

What are the main game modes?

The app offers several game modes, including an 'around the world' style three-point shooting competition, a one-on-one mode, and a survive and advance ACC tournament bracket. It also features online multiplayer for head-to-head matchups.

Is ACC 3 Point Challenge free to play?

Yes, the application is free to download and play. However, it does contain advertisements.

How do I score extra points in the game?

Players can score extra points by hitting 'MONEY BALLS' and by catching fire and staying hot during shooting streaks. These mechanics are designed to reward skillful play and momentum.
